Any LMS system that supports LTI can use EvaluationKIT as an LTI Service Provide (LTI SP) and authenticate users in EvaluationKIT, if matching usernames exist in EvaluationKIT.
Sakai And Generic LTI Integration Steps
- If LTI is not currently enabled for your EvaluationKIT Account (check Account > Integrations > LTI), send a request to eksupport@watermarkinsights.com to enable LTI for your account in EvaluationKIT.
- Login to your account in EvaluationKIT and click on Account > Integrations > LTI.
- The LTI integration requires Consumer Key, Shared Secret Key and the URL (#1 in the image below). Version 1.0 just indicates that EvaluationKIT supports LTI 1.0. Use this information to configure the LTI in the 3rd party (e.g. LMS) system.
- The LTI sends user info, including usernames, in the requests. You will need to identify what parameter carries username.

Once you identify the username parameter name, you will then add that to "Username Parameter Name" in the EvaluationKIT LTI settings page (#2 in the image below) and save.
These directions are for the the user integration only, and provides a static link to EvaluationKIT.
NOTE
If you are also using the Instructure Canvas LMS, changing the Username Parameter Name would affect the Canvas LMS integration. This change will NOT affect other LMS integrations.LTI 1.3 Integration Steps
- Login to your account in Course Evaluations & Surveys and click on Account > Integrations > LTI 1.3.

- The LTI 1.3 integration requires Issuer, Client ID, Deployment ID, Public Keyset URL, Authentication Request URL. Use this information to configure the LTI in the 3rd party (e.g. LMS) system.

These directions are for the the user integration only, and provides a static link to Course Evaluations & Surveys.
